Rep. Kinzer Testifies on Immigration Reform Legislation
On Monday, February 25th Rep. Kinzer testified before the House Federal & State Affairs Committee in favor of HB 2836. Rep. Kinzer and 22 co-sponsors introduced HB 2836 which, among other things, imposes penalties on employers who knowingly hire illegal aliens and limits access to public benefits for illegal aliens. To see Rep. Kinzer’s testimony on this bill look here.

Rep. Kinzer Works Hard on Illegal Immigrant Benefit Issue
Last week the House Committee on Federal & State Affairs held hearings on HB 2367. This bill was introduced by Rep. Kinzer and would require state agencies to verify citizenship of persons seeking certain public benefits. To learn more about this issue see Rep. Kinzer's testimony on this bill.

Lance Gives Lecture at Signs of Life in Lawrence
On October 6, State Rep. Lance Kinzer wgave a lecture at the Signs of Life Christian bookstore in Downtown Lawrence, Kansas. The lecture, entitled "Russell Kirk and the Politics of Prudence", was part of the Public House at Signs of Life Lecture Series.

Dr. Kirk is author of the 1953 book The Cosnervative Mind. Lance will focus on the importance of the principles discussed in the book to the development of an aunthentic conservative approach to public policy.
